[Cryptech Tech] Specifications and test vectors for RSA

Joachim Strömbergson joachim at secworks.se
Fri Dec 5 11:18:28 UTC 2014


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256

Aloha!

Rob Austein wrote:
> Also, Joachim sends a plea for test vectors, which he has not been 
> able to find.   Given the part of RSA that he thinks he's doing,
> this means: please supply sample input to the RSA process with
> padding already done, along with the corresponding expected output
> for a supplied RSA keypair.   Plan is to collect a few of these, put
> them up for scrutiny to make sure we believe that they're correct,
> then use them as test vectors for the Verilog code.

Yes, that would be very helpful. And if possible for 1024, 2048, 4096
and possible even 8192 keys.

Basically:

Message (M)  = 0x...
Exponent (e) = 0x...
Modulus (n)  = 0x...
Expected     = 0x...

Thanks for any help.

- -- 
Med vänlig hälsning, Yours

Joachim Strömbergson - Alltid i harmonisk svängning.
========================================================================
 Joachim Strömbergson          Secworks AB          joachim at secworks.se
========================================================================
-----BEGIN PGP SIGNATURE-----
Version: GnuPG/MacGPG2 v2
Comment: GPGTools - http://gpgtools.org
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iQIcBAEBCAAGBQJUgZSEAAoJEF3cfFQkIuyN5u8P/RTDS2ShDTNGDNhQdHpWaoaY
D1wJVo31k5CPo0QlxJogz+8w634Pil1iiUfoo3lVpLr5rXA73guk16qLCCK/OBJu
3vj3VefTlKDfil0SkH+aQmZXzMPy0VBHju/reyZw6sK5BZ39+1Pfyma5qsOWvx/r
Q07oGEj1SgMxBbivmUP/hxa8ENVnI/bYEGbRSgb9+NaA/9ZupqmI4KOohbLzt23G
poMnnJMGFPil8JHNXLcIjucL0Uz1RmsQH1rJWNgAaDtKy+2lmccQuqEPzWto1y2W
EYE+HjnYQ1OPy2jJX5zgcwL+LFXyCayENc2dpfQSPqxsNSZRWZKxO+SLAyXAMP/G
WknC3UX1cOHF/3rfYIVSIRfRGHQEWSNFnaYKrF76VxMSGwnhkUNwmQl5JFv98f3m
TvYxLuz1Z81FyQtRsXEmyoSXuP9iMKpPkJw8gf5wziL/KrRv3rW0V1jEfQm9ywes
iFrkxXZVeeyjn3lnwGwE2o1eEIGmKujoMMSV5wHnXttNw/Nnf8qzQRDGIt2zUb7C
e2zfMFtZwjmeOPS7bQN5yn1KdTyVXBcAffX1adWoTZFD0ilddPbf6OkRoBphI6/r
VIR3TFbtGJo4u17X8JF+AGuNYcS22wEge3Jlag0TXsUxU5VMxN9oPGyf0d9cO3Vh
OJMgTzOo0Ad3aGbmwEoO
=bhZH
-----END PGP SIGNATURE-----


More information about the Tech mailing list